
2.2 Basic Simple Interface Mode
The basic simple interface mode allows you to easily write a program or data in flash memory on the target device
without creating a project and registering and storing device information.
This mode is called by selecting "Flash Development Toolkit 3.4 Basic" in the Start menu. This mode is used to
simplify the look and feel of the Flash Development Toolkit.
In the basic simple interface mode, any previous settings are restored at the start-up. To change the device, kernel, or
port settings, select [Options -> New Settings...]. The wizard is started up and collects new settings.
